Who wins the Data Duel between Suriname and Maldives?
Maldives wins the Data Duel 9-1 across the 12 indicators compared. The comparison covers GDP, population, life expectancy, CO₂ emissions, and 8 more indicators sourced from the World Bank.
How do Suriname and Maldives compare on GDP?
Suriname has a GDP of $4.7 billion, while Maldives has $7.0 billion. Maldives leads on this indicator.
How do Suriname and Maldives compare on GDP per Capita?
Suriname has a GDP per Capita of $7,430.702, while Maldives has $13,215.535. Maldives leads on this indicator.
How do Suriname and Maldives compare on Population?
Suriname has a Population of 634,431, while Maldives has 527,799. they are comparable on this indicator.
How do Suriname and Maldives compare on Life Expectancy?
Suriname has a Life Expectancy of 73.6, while Maldives has 81.0. Maldives leads on this indicator.
How do Suriname and Maldives compare on GDP Growth?
Suriname has a GDP Growth of 2.8%, while Maldives has 5.1%. Maldives leads on this indicator.
